  Song: Art In Me
  Artist: Jars of Clay
  Album: Jars of Clay
  copyright 1995, pogostick records

  This is just the intro tab, the other tab was somewhat off.


  Capo 3


  E-----------0-------0-------0-------0--|
  B---------0-------0-------0-------0----|   Repeat X times.
  G-------------2-------4-------2--------|
  D----2h4-------------------------------| 

  
    The other tab looks pretty solid as far as the regular chords go,
    I haven't tried it out yet.

Almost correct, it should be:

e-|----------0-----0------0-----0---|-
B-|--------0-----0------0-----0-----|-
G-|------1-----2------4-----2-------|-
D-|--2h4----------------------------|-

keep your #1finger (pointer) on G-1 and then add #2 (middle finger)to G-2 and slide that fingering up to G-4 and back down to G-2. That way you are all set for the second time through it. You can hear the slide on the recording.

Actually it is a double hammer: in EABEBE (capo 3)

e-|----------0-----0------0-----0---|-
b-|--------0-----0------0-----0-----|-
E-|--0h2h4-----5------7-----5-------|- repeat until middle of 1st verse
B-|---------------------------------|-
A-|---------------------------------|-
E-|---------------------------------|-
1 3 3 3 1

If you listen closely to the track, you'll hear some string squeak from the sliding of the ring finger.
